Distance and Travel Time from Cao Bang to Ha Giang

How far is Cao Bang from Ha Giang?

The journey from Cao Bang to Ha Giang covers approximately 250 kilometers. Situated in the northeastern region of Vietnam, these two destinations are known for their breathtaking landscapes and rich cultural heritage.

Estimated Travel Time

Traveling between Cao Bang and Ha Giang typically takes around 7 to 8 hours by bus. The travel time can vary depending on the road conditions and the mode of transportation.

Best Routes for the Journey

Route via National Road 34

The most popular route between Cao Bang to Ha Giang is via National Road 34. This road provides a direct connection between the two provinces, offering a relatively straightforward path with stunning views along the way.

Considerations for Traveling by Motorbike

For the adventurous at heart, traveling by motorbike is an option. However, be prepared for a more challenging journey. The roads, especially near Binh Nguyen, can be rough and require careful navigation. The ride can be exhausting, but it offers an intimate experience of the landscape and local life.

Transportation Options from Cao Bang to Ha Giang

Bus Services

Currently, the primary mode of inter-provincial travel from Cao Bang to Ha Giang is by bus. The most common choice is the 30-seat bus, which, despite being a bit cramped, provides a practical means of transportation through the mountainous terrain.

Motorbike Travel

Motorbike travel is also popular among those who enjoy a more flexible and adventurous mode of transport. It allows you to explore remote areas and enjoy panoramic views that you might miss on a bus.

Must-See Attractions Along the Way

Scenic Spots and Natural Wonders on the road from Cao Bang to Ha Giang

  • Ban Gioc Waterfall: One of the most majestic waterfalls in Vietnam, located near Trùng Khánh. Its three-tiered cascade and surrounding landscape make it a must-see.

     

  • Nguom Ngao Cave: Known for its stunning stalactite and stalagmite formations, this cave is a natural wonder worth visiting.

     

  • Thang Hen Lake: A picturesque cluster of 36 lakes surrounded by lush greenery, ideal for a serene getaway.

     

Cultural and Historical Sites

  • Pac Bo Cave: A historic site where Hồ Chí Minh lived and worked during his early revolutionary activities. It’s a place of profound historical significance.

     

  • Phat Tich Truc Lam Pagoda: A serene Buddhist temple that offers insights into local spiritual practices and stunning views of the surrounding countryside.
